Ideon,
I have a Bibler Pinon that is sitting here doing nothing.
Paddy Pallin had them at $1299 RRP and $950 (?) on sale.
They were sold as a 3 season tent but only because they are not full enclosed as their standard tents but the pole structure is more than good enough for snow use.
2 layer Gore-Tex with fuzzy Nextec fur to absorb condensation for the living area, nylon for the vestibules.
Image
Image
3x equal size 9.5mm poles , fully freestanding including vestibules.
Like the Awanee but with built in vestibules.
$300 plus postage.
2.8kg (ouch!)
Not all that obvious (to some) on how to set it up but easy once you know ( I can help...)
